FAQs

Q1: What is Iron Oxide Hydroxide Dispersion?

Iron oxide hydroxide dispersion is a stable suspension of FeO(OH) particles in a liquid medium, used for pigments, coatings, water treatment, and advanced research applications.

Q2: How is Iron Oxide Hydroxide Dispersion applied in industrial coatings?

It provides uniform color, improved corrosion resistance, and better adhesion when incorporated into paints, varnishes, and protective coatings.

Q3: What benefits does this dispersion offer over dry iron oxide hydroxide?

The dispersion ensures even particle distribution, reduces dust hazards, simplifies handling, and allows precise formulation in liquid-based applications.

Q4: Which industries commonly use Iron Oxide Hydroxide Dispersion?

It is used in pigments and paints, wastewater treatment, ceramics, catalysts, and research laboratories focused on nanomaterials and functional coatings.

Q5: What storage and handling practices maintain dispersion quality?

Store in tightly sealed containers in a cool, dry place. Avoid contamination and gently stir before use to ensure homogeneity and consistent performance.
